Litchfield Park, Arizona - Sharlene Ann Taylor

passed away peacefully on Jan 8th, at home with her husband Robert by her side. Whom she married on

June 4th 1960.

Sharlene was born in Table Rock

Nebraska September 27, 1942.

She was a talented musician who sang in the choir and played the organ professionally for Saint Thomas Aquinas Catholic Church.

Sharlene had a life long love for horses, music and travel.

She is preceded in death by her parents, Marion and Elaine Bonham and one brother Michael Bonham.

She is survived by her husband Robert R Taylor and her 3 sons James (Jan) of Wyoming. Randy (Karen)of Arizona and Robert M (Tania) of Florida. She was survived by many grandchildren and great grandchildren.

A service was held for family immediately following her passing
